Pilot for a Day roams with the Nomads

The 33rd Maintenance Squadron’s wizard mascot kneels in front of an F-35A Lightning II with Pilot for a Day, Christian Loafman, whose name was placed on the aircraft at Eglin Air Force Base, Fla., May 18, 2016. During his visit, Christian was greeted by military members dressed as superheroes who guided him through the maintenance portion of his tour. (U.S. Air Force photo/Senior Airman Andrea Posey)
